  2. Christmas at Cold Comfort Farm (actually a collection of short stories, of which Christmas was the first) was published in 1940. It is a prequel of sorts, set before Flora's arrival at the farm, and is a parody of a typical family Christmas. Conference at Cold Comfort Farm, a sequel, was published in 1949 to mixed reviews.
